Parallel Tall-and-Skinny QR Factorization Based on LU-CholeskyQR Algorithm
We present optimal parallel QR factorization algorithms with reduced communication overhead. QR factorization is widely applied to solve various problems in numerical linear algebra. Our focus is on problems involving dense tall-and-skinny matrices in large-scale parallel distributed memory systems....
